Output 6eefcc045d7bb82e2a35569d2ee25b2af9f92b1f74c163a3be708958d2c0bb35:0

value
2896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ee6f09d24452859ce093f756b782ed2b28b46e OP_EQUAL
address
3QCfnQD8xi9o8Y3hcEVkAFXWbwy2h9xNU4
transaction
6eefcc045d7bb82e2a35569d2ee25b2af9f92b1f74c163a3be708958d2c0bb35
confirmations
366445
spent
true